Course Content

• Foundations of Bilingualism and Second Language Acquisition
• Linguistic Diversity in the Classroom: Understanding Dialects and Language Variation
• Culturally Responsive Teaching for Dual Language Learners
• Assessment and Intervention Strategies for Dual Language Learners
• Developing Dual Language Learner Participation: Instructional Strategies and Practices
• Sheltered Instruction Observation Protocol (SIOP) Model and Implementation
• Family and Community Engagement with Dual Language Learners
• Differentiation and Modification for Diverse Learners
• Technology Integration for Dual Language Learners

A Graduate Certificate in Dual Language Learner Participation equips educators with the specialized knowledge and skills to effectively support the academic and linguistic development of dual language learners (DLLs) in diverse educational settings. This program focuses on evidence-based best practices and culturally responsive teaching methodologies.


Learning outcomes for this certificate include developing proficiency in assessing DLLs' language proficiency and academic needs, designing and implementing differentiated instruction tailored to DLLs' unique linguistic and cultural backgrounds, and collaborating effectively with families and communities to create supportive learning environments. Graduates will also gain expertise in bilingual education and sheltered instruction.
